Daria Kasatkina enters the Strasbourg quarterfinal with strong momentum after capturing the WTA 125 La Bisbal title and posting four consecutive straight-set wins, including a victory over Liudmila Samsonova. The Russian leads the head-to-head 3-1, with a 1-0 edge on clay, though Jaqueline Cristian claimed their most recent encounter in straight sets on hard courts in Adelaide earlier this year. Cristian reached this stage with a 6-1, 7-5 win over Clara Tauson but has shown less consistent results on clay compared to her 2025 form, while sitting at a career-high ranking near No. 28. Kasatkina’s additional match experience in the draw and comfort on the surface position her as the clearer favorite in the eyes of traders assessing this WTA 500 matchup.
